NathanSweet dd27ee184c Changed Spine export format.
There are no longer separate animation files, they are now inside the skeleton file. This means there is just one file to manage, which is cleaner. Now that animations are stored in SkeletonData, they can be looked up by name which leads to cleaner runtime APIs.

cocos2d and cocos2d-x runtimes got a cleaner ObjC/C++ API.

package com.esotericsoftware.spine;
import com.badlogic.gdx.ApplicationAdapter;
import com.badlogic.gdx.Gdx;
import com.badlogic.gdx.Input.Keys;
import com.badlogic.gdx.InputAdapter;
import com.badlogic.gdx.backends.lwjgl.LwjglApplication;
import com.badlogic.gdx.backends.lwjgl.LwjglApplicationConfiguration;
import com.badlogic.gdx.files.FileHandle;
import com.badlogic.gdx.graphics.Color;
import com.badlogic.gdx.graphics.GL10;
import com.badlogic.gdx.graphics.Pixmap;
import com.badlogic.gdx.graphics.Pixmap.Format;
import com.badlogic.gdx.graphics.Texture;
import com.badlogic.gdx.graphics.g2d.SpriteBatch;
import com.badlogic.gdx.graphics.g2d.TextureAtlas;
import com.badlogic.gdx.graphics.g2d.TextureAtlas.AtlasRegion;
import com.badlogic.gdx.graphics.g2d.TextureAtlas.TextureAtlasData;
import com.badlogic.gdx.graphics.glutils.ShapeRenderer;
public class SkeletonTest extends ApplicationAdapter {
SpriteBatch batch;
float time;
ShapeRenderer renderer;
SkeletonData skeletonData;
Skeleton skeleton;
Animation animation;
public void create () {
batch = new SpriteBatch();
renderer = new ShapeRenderer();
final String name = "goblins"; // "spineboy";
// A regular texture atlas would normally usually be used. This returns a white image for images not found in the atlas.
Pixmap pixmap = new Pixmap(32, 32, Format.RGBA8888);
pixmap.setColor(Color.WHITE);
pixmap.fill();
final AtlasRegion fake = new AtlasRegion(new Texture(pixmap), 0, 0, 32, 32);
pixmap.dispose();
FileHandle atlasFile = Gdx.files.internal(name + ".atlas");
TextureAtlasData data = !atlasFile.exists() ? null : new TextureAtlasData(atlasFile, atlasFile.parent(), false);
TextureAtlas atlas = new TextureAtlas(data) {
public AtlasRegion findRegion (String name) {
AtlasRegion region = super.findRegion(name);
return region != null ? region : fake;
}
};
if (true) {
SkeletonJson json = new SkeletonJson(atlas);
// json.setScale(2);
skeletonData = json.readSkeletonData(Gdx.files.internal(name + ".json"));
} else {
SkeletonBinary binary = new SkeletonBinary(atlas);
// binary.setScale(2);
skeletonData = binary.readSkeletonData(Gdx.files.internal(name + ".skel"));
}
animation = skeletonData.findAnimation("walk");
skeleton = new Skeleton(skeletonData);
if (name.equals("goblins")) skeleton.setSkin("goblin");
skeleton.setToBindPose();
Bone root = skeleton.getRootBone();
root.x = 50;
root.y = 20;
root.scaleX = 1f;
root.scaleY = 1f;
skeleton.updateWorldTransform();
Gdx.input.setInputProcessor(new InputAdapter() {
public boolean keyDown (int keycode) {
if (keycode == Keys.SPACE) {
if (name.equals("goblins")) {
skeleton.setSkin(skeleton.getSkin().getName().equals("goblin") ? "goblingirl" : "goblin");
skeleton.setSlotsToBindPose();
}
}
return true;
}
});
}
public void render () {
time += Gdx.graphics.getDeltaTime();
Bone root = skeleton.getRootBone();
float x = root.getX() + 160 * Gdx.graphics.getDeltaTime() * (skeleton.getFlipX() ? -1 : 1);
if (x > Gdx.graphics.getWidth()) skeleton.setFlipX(true);
if (x < 0) skeleton.setFlipX(false);
root.setX(x);
Gdx.gl.glClear(GL10.GL_COLOR_BUFFER_BIT);
batch.begin();
batch.setColor(Color.GRAY);
animation.apply(skeleton, time, true);
skeleton.updateWorldTransform();
skeleton.update(Gdx.graphics.getDeltaTime());
skeleton.draw(batch);
batch.end();
skeleton.drawDebug(renderer);
}
public void resize (int width, int height) {
batch.getProjectionMatrix().setToOrtho2D(0, 0, width, height);
renderer.setProjectionMatrix(batch.getProjectionMatrix());
}
public static void main (String[] args) throws Exception {
new LwjglApplication(new SkeletonTest());
}
}
